







Steel support nuts are the unsung heroes within steel support systems, playing a vital role as connecting and fastening components. These nuts find prominence in crucial engineering sectors like building foundation pit support and bridge construction. Here's an in-depth exploration of their multifaceted attributes:
• Structure and Materials
Structure: Predominantly hexagonal or circular in shape, these nuts feature internal threads, perfectly designed to engage with steel-supported screws. Secure fastening is achieved through rotational force. Enhanced with a stiffening rib plate at one end, they ensure increased contact surface and stress stability between the nut and steel support. Some variations incorporate protrusions or grooves, enabling synergy with complementary gaskets to effectively thwart loosening.
Material: Crafted from high-strength steel such as 45# steel or Q345 steel, these nuts undergo processes like forging and heat treatment. This meticulous preparation enhances their strength and toughness, meeting the stringent engineering demands for structural stability and safety.
• Function and Purpose
Load Transmission: Within the steel support system, these nuts serve as pillars of strength. Through threaded engagement with screws, they efficiently transfer axial forces to all components, ensuring a balanced load distribution and unshakeable support system stability.
Adjusting Length: With a simple rotation, these nuts offer precise fine-tuning of the steel support's length, facilitating a seamless fit to the foundation pit or any other construction element. This adaptability meets diverse engineering size demands and ensures impeccable support.
Tightening and Anti-Loosening: Working in harmony with gaskets and bolts, these nuts masterfully tighten connections, preventing any loosening or dislodgement of steel support components. They are the guardians against vibration, stress, and other construction challenges, safeguarding construction safety.
• Application Scenarios
Building Foundation Pit Support: In the realm of deep foundation pit construction, these steel support nuts are the anchors that secure steel supports to the enclosure structure. They bravely combat soil and water pressure, maintaining pit stability and ensuring the safety of subsequent underground construction.
Tunnel Construction: During initial and temporary tunnel support phases, these nuts connect critical components like steel arches and pipes. They provide a stable operational haven for tunnel projects, averting potential collapse incidents.
Bridge Engineering: Throughout formwork support and various bridge construction stages, these nuts are essential in maintaining the stability of support structures. They ensure smooth execution of pouring and installation processes for bridge elements, enabling flawless construction progress.
